    It is defnitely not - read the article again. Titan have already said that its the same cooler as the previous with the only 'REAL' difference being the fan. just buy a Scythe Gentle Typhoon 120mm fan. It doesnt come in the same gold colour or have PWM function but it looks just like the one titan are using.     most case fans dont have PWM, and also their CFM and static air pressure is quite weak. one of the reasons the fenrir does so well is that the fan can ramp up to a huge CFM but is very noisy. if this new fan can do a similar CFM and static air pressure but quieter then its worth an upgrade.
